*Recipe Adapted from Jerusalem: A Cookbook*(
Ingredients you’ll need:
Dough-
3 1/3 cup (530g) all purpose flour
1/2 cup (100g) granulated sugar
3 teaspoons (10g) instant yeast
3/4 cup (175g) lukewarm water (90 degrees F)
3 large eggs
10 tablespoons (150g) unsalted butter, room temp
3/4 teaspoon (3g) fine sea salt
neutral tasting oil for greasing
Chocolate paste-
6.5 oz (180g) dark chocolate (70 percent or higher)
1/2 cup (120g) unsalted butter
3/4 cup (105g) powdered sugar
1/2 cup plus 1 tbsp (42g) cocoa powder
*optional* freshly grated nutmeg (1/8 teaspoon)
small pinch of salt
